WebThe following ranges of permissive growth temperatures are approximate only and can vary according to other environmental factors. Organisms categorized as mesophile s (“middle loving”) are adapted to moderate temperatures, with optimal growth temperatures ranging from room temperature (about 20 °C) to about 45 °C.

Web7 jul. 2024 · Organisms have the ability to produce offspring, via asexual or sexual reproduction. Asexual reproduction involves one parent and produces offspring that are genetically identical to each other. WebLife Science Resources. Early Life on Earth – Animal Origins. Depiction of one of Earth’s ocean communities, including the top predator Anomalocaris, during the Cambrian Period 510 million years ago. By the end of the Cambrian, nearly all the major groups of animals we know today (the phyla) had evolved. Depiction by Karen Carr, Smithsonian.
